建立一张学生表,要求学号(Sno)为主码,姓名(Sname)唯一。 CREATE TABLE Student
(
( Sno CHAR(8) ________,
Sname VARCHAR(20) ______,
Ssex CHAR(6),
Sbirthdate Date,
Smajor VARCHAR(40)
);
2、建立一个课程表,要求课程号(Cno)不能为空。
CREATE TABLE Course
(
Cno CHAR(5) 主码,
Cname VARCHAR(40) ________,
Ccredit SMALLINT,
Cpno CHAR(5),
省略参照完整性关系....
);
3、建立学生选课表,要求补全参照完整性关系。
CREATE TABLE SC
(Sno CHAR(8),
Cno CHAR(5),
Grade SMALLINT,
Semester CHAR(5),
Teachingclass CHAR(8),
省略表级实体完整性约束,
/*表级完整性约束,Sno是外码,被参照表是Student */
FOREIGN KEY (Sno) REFERENCES Student(_____), (Sno)
/*表级完整性约束,Cno是外码,被参照表是Course*/
FOREIGN KEY (Cno) REFERENCES Course(_____)(Cno)
);